在Code Composer Studio中,如何正确设置开发环境以适配TI DSP项目,并且提高构建速度?
时间: 2024-11-03 18:11:02 浏览: 32
正确配置Code Composer Studio(CCS)以适应TI DSP开发环境并优化构建速度,是确保项目顺利进行和缩短开发周期的关键步骤。首先,你需要下载并安装最新的CCS版本,然后进行必要的环境配置,具体步骤如下:
参考资源链接:[Code Composer Studio v3.3 中文使用手册](https://wenku.csdn.net/doc/5vyqeqfti6?spm=1055.2569.3001.10343)
1. **安装和更新**:确保安装了与你的TI DSP硬件相匹配的CCS版本。访问TI官方网站下载最新版本,并执行安装。安装过程中,保持网络连接,以便自动下载和安装额外的工具和插件。
2. **创建项目**:打开CCS,通过“File”菜单选择“New”然后“Project”来创建一个新项目。选择合适的项目模板,如“Empty Project”,并填写项目名称和路径。在下一步中,选择与你的TI DSP对应的处理器系列和具体型号。
3. **配置构建选项**:右键点击项目,选择“Properties”,在弹出的对话框中配置构建选项。确保包含正确的包含路径、库文件和定义符号,这些将直接关系到代码编译的正确性。
4. **配置构建器设置**:在“Project Properties”中,进入“Build”选项卡,查看和调整构建器设置。这里可以设置编译优化等级,以提高代码效率和构建速度。
5. **启用优化选项**:在“Build Settings”中启用代码优化选项,例如选择不同的优化级别(如-O1, -O2, -O3等),但需注意,某些优化可能会牺牲代码的调试能力。
6. **管理项目资源**:合理组织项目文件和文件夹结构,使用Makefile或者自定义构建脚本来管理复杂的项目资源和依赖关系。
7. **调试器设置**:在“Debug”配置中,选择合适的调试器配置,确保调试器能正确连接到你的DSP目标硬件。
8. **使用GCC编译器**:如果需要,可以在CCS中配置GCC编译器,以实现更加灵活的编译选项和更好的构建性能。
9. **性能分析工具**:利用CCS提供的性能分析工具,如Code Composer Studio Profiler,找出代码中可能导致构建缓慢的部分,并进行优化。
10. **索引和缓存**:允许CCS对代码进行索引和缓存,尤其是在处理大型项目时,这能显著减少代码编辑和重新构建的时间。
通过以上步骤,你可以有效地配置CCS以适应TI DSP开发,并最大化优化项目构建的速度。实践过程中可能会遇到各种问题,此时可以参考《Code Composer Studio v3.3 中文使用手册》中的详细说明和实践经验分享,进一步深化理解并解决实际问题。
参考资源链接:[Code Composer Studio v3.3 中文使用手册](https://wenku.csdn.net/doc/5vyqeqfti6?spm=1055.2569.3001.10343)
阅读全文